Rabies is a deadly viral disease that attacks the nervous system, primarily transmitted through the bite of an infected animal. Ayurveda classifies rabies as a severe Vata-Pitta disorder due to its effects on the nerves (Vata) and the feverish, inflammatory symptoms (Pitta). While occasional numbness, tingling, and dizziness are more likely signs of nerve sensitivity or dehydration rather than rabies, persistent neurological symptoms should always be evaluated by a doctor. Rabies requires immediate medical treatment, including post-exposure prophylaxis (PEP) if bitten, as Ayurveda alone cannot cure the disease.

To strengthen the nervous system and immunity, Ayurveda emphasizes a Vata-Pitta pacifying lifestyle. Herbs like Brahmi and Shankhpushpi help support brain function and calm the nervous system, while Ashwagandha strengthens nerve health and reduces stress. Tulsi and Neem are known for their antiviral and immune-boosting properties, which can help protect against infections. Ayurvedic formulations like Chyawanprash and Guduchi Satva help enhance immunity, while Rasayana (rejuvenation) therapies support overall vitality and resilience.

A balanced diet plays a crucial role in preventing infections. Ayurveda recommends fresh, seasonal, and easily digestible foods to strengthen immunity. Including ghee, almonds, green leafy vegetables, Amla, and coconut water can nourish the nervous system and boost overall health. Processed foods, excess sugar, and artificial additives should be avoided as they weaken digestion and immunity. Herbal teas made from Ginger, Turmeric, and Tulsi can provide daily immune support. Hydration with warm water and herbal infusions helps flush out toxins and maintain proper circulation.

Preventative care is key to avoiding rabies exposure. Ayurveda advises maintaining cleanliness, avoiding contact with stray animals, and strengthening immunity to resist infections. Abhyanga (self-massage with herbal oils like Mahanarayan Taila) can calm the nervous system, while Pranayama and meditation help manage stress, which indirectly supports immunity. However, if exposed to a potential rabies risk, immediate medical care is essential, and Ayurvedic support can be used alongside conventional treatment for faster recovery and overall well-being.
